Carlos Alcaraz has secured a place in the Australian Open final after an intense five-set encounter against Alexander Zverev. The world number one demonstrated remarkable resilience and endurance, overcoming the German opponent in a match that lasted nearly five and a half hours. The final scoreline stood at 6-4, 7-6(5), 6-7(3), 6-7(4), 7-5, reflecting the closely contested nature of the semi-final clash.
Throughout the match, both players displayed exceptional athleticism and tactical awareness. Alcaraz managed to claim the first two sets, utilizing powerful baseline shots and strategic serves. Zverev responded by elevating his game, capturing the next two sets via tiebreaks to level the match. In the decisive set, Alcaraz maintained composure under pressure, ultimately securing victory and advancing to the final round.
This achievement puts Alcaraz on the verge of making tennis history. With one more victory, he could become the youngest player ever to complete a career Grand Slam, having already won major titles at the French Open, Wimbledon, and the US Open. His impressive run in Melbourne has drawn attention from tennis enthusiasts and analysts worldwide, who are keenly observing his pursuit of this historic milestone.
Looking ahead, Alcaraz will face either the defending champion Jannik Sinner or the record-holding Grand Slam winner Novak Djokovic in the championship final. Both potential opponents present significant challenges, with Sinner aiming to retain his title and Djokovic seeking to extend his remarkable Grand Slam record.
The Australian Open final is set to be a high-stakes showdown, featuring some of the sport's most talented and accomplished figures.
